Stevenson Retain 2015 Driver Squad For 2016 IMSA Audi Effort

Stevenson Motorsport’s new look 2016 season with the Audi R8 LMS will still feature plenty of very familiar faces as the drivers and crew behind the IMSA WeatherTech SportsCar Championship two car effort are carried over from the team’s successful Continental Tire Sportscar Championship campaign last year.

The finalization of the 2016 FIA driver categorizations means that the 2015 championship-winning duo of Andrew Davis and Robin Liddell are now confirmed aboard the #6 Stevenson Motorsports Audi R8 LMS, while Americans Matt Bell and Lawson Aschenbach will be co-drivers in the sister #9 car.

2016 will be the third consecutive season as co-drivers for Davis and Liddell as Bell and Aschenbach team for a second straight year.

“We are really happy to be able to keep these four guys together for our move up to WeatherTech in 2016,” said team owner John Stevenson, who himself raced to a GT class podium in his racing debut in 2003 at Watkins Glen. “A lot of our crew has been with us for a long time, and it shows with how well they operate as a team. This is going to be a very competitive championship, so having a great team behind Andrew, Robin, Matt and Lawson – hopefully that will help us get off to a good start in the 24 and be competitive all year long.”

The #6 Stevenson Motorsport Audi R8 LMS will break cover this week at the Performance Racing Industry show as part of the combined IMSA and NASCAR display.

With support from Audi Sport customer racing, Stevenson Motorsports will make its first official outing with the Audi R8 LMS at the Roar Before the 24 test at Daytona International Speedway in January. The team will announce its endurance lineup ahead of the Roar Before the 24, which is set to begin on Jan. 7.
